Analysis

Barbados recorded 60.64 kt for emissions on agricultural land — emissions (co2eq) in 2023.

The figure is up 0.1% on the previous year and down 3.0% over ten years.

Over the whole period, emissions on agricultural land — emissions (co2eq) in Barbados peaked at 110.98 kt in 1995 and was at its lowest, 57.21 kt, in 2007.

Barbados ranks 175th of 222 countries on this measure, in the bottom quarter.

The long-run direction has been consistently falling across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
